15-20 RESIDENTS ARE AFFECTED BY FIBER CUT!
While crews were repairing a water main break near the school, they cut a fiber line which provides service to 15-20 individuals in that area. City of Barnesville requests residents to conserve power!
Barnesville Municipal Power is asking customers to conserve energy today during this cold weather to help reduce demand on the power grid. This request comes from (MISO), which operates the energy market and controls electrical reliability for our region.
